What is a Party Pack?We make a variety of games designed to appeal to everyone in the room, Zoom call, or Twitch stream. Drawing games, writing games, trivia games, hidden identity games… no party-goer gets left behind. Every year since 2014, we’ve released a new collection of games, grouped together as a Jackbox Party Pack. In each pack, you’ll find 5 different games that can accommodate from 1-8 players. If you have more people in your group, then (1) congrats on your effortless popularity and (2) many of our games allow audience play-along, meaning they can still jump in and be part of the fun! We also have some awesome standalone titles that exist outside of the Party Packs, like Drawful 2. OK, I’ve purchased a party pack! Is there anything my friends or family need to do to play with me?All your players need is a smartphone or web-enabled device! Look at us, really lean into that prolonged eye-contact: there is no app or additional purchase needed in order for them to play. They only need a mobile device; a way to access the internet; and to be able to see the screen running the game. How do I get a Jackbox Game Started?You’ve purchased a Party Pack. You’ve gathered your squad. All you need is to start the game and play! We have a helpful video tutorial and step-by-step instructions for how to connect all of your players to the game here. That page also covers information about how to access additional features and customization options for each game. The key is making sure everyone in your group (either in person or remotely) can see and hear the screen running the game. This will allow them to see the room code and join, and to see what’s happening in the game and play along. What should I do if I experience issues while playing a Jackbox Game?We have an amazing support site, with lots of tips and troubleshooting methods, here. You can also submit a ticket to our support team. They endeavor to respond within 1-3 business days. Holidays may take a little longer if we’re slammed. But here’s our biggest pro tip: if a player’s mobile device gets disconnected during the game… they should try refreshing their web browser. Very often they’ll be instantly reconnected. If not, let us know. Like we said: no party-goer left behind.

[H1] How to Play Jackbox Games [H2] Step by Step Instructions 1Purchase a Party Pack from a storefront of choice and install it Only one person in your group needs to own a Jackbox product in order to host the game. The host can buy a party pack from any of our storefronts and install it on their device-of-choice. 2Launch the Party Pack, and hit “play” on a game Once you hit play, the game will open a lobby room. This room is where you and your players gather before hitting start. 3Gather your group, whether in-person or remote. Players can join the lobby room by visiting jackbox.tv using the room code on the host’s screen. If you’re playing in person, the host screen should be visible to the whole room. If you’re playing remote, the host can use a screen sharing app like Discord or Zoom. 4Use phones as controllers Players can join the lobby room by visiting jackbox.tv using the room code on the host’s screen. Once everybody is in, with device in hand, launch the game from the host screen and have fun. These are the structural rules a local, deterministic auditor applies — the same lens you can use to judge each signal. They describe what to look for, not this company’s result.
Classify each sentence as substantive or hollow. Grounding markers — numbers, currencies, dates, technical units, named entities — outweigh marketing adjectives. When fluff sits right next to hard evidence, the fluff is forgiven.
Pull the main entities out of the H1, then check whether they actually recur through the body. A page that announces one thing and then talks about another drifts. Headings with no real sentences underneath read as pseudo-substance.
Count trust words (review, testimonial, rating, verified) against real outbound proof links (Google, Trustpilot, Clutch, G2, Yelp). Lots of trust language with zero verification links is trust theatre. Unlinked logo galleries count against it.
Look at how much sentence length varies. Natural writing varies its rhythm; templated or mass-produced copy is statistically uniform. Very low variation reads as commodity content — unless unique named entities break the pattern.
Inspect the JSON-LD. Is there an Organization or Person schema, and does it carry sameAs links to real external profiles (LinkedIn, socials)? Missing schema or no identity declaration signals an anonymous entity.
